Understanding Ceramic Tile Floors
Ceramic tiles are made from natural clays and minerals, fired at high temperatures to create a durable, non-porous surface. They are resistant to stains, moisture, and bacteria, making them ideal for high-traffic areas like kitchens and bathrooms. However, they can be sensitive to harsh chemicals and acidic substances, which can dull their finish or cause damage.

Cleaning Your Ceramic Tile Floor

Before you begin, ensure your floor is free of any large debris or dirt. Then, follow these steps:
- Dip a mop or sponge into the cleaning solution.
- Mop the floor in sections, working from one corner of the room to the other. Be sure to overlap each section to ensure thorough coverage.
- Rinse the mop or sponge frequently to prevent spreading dirt and grime.
- Rinse the floor thoroughly with clean water to remove any residue. A clean, damp mop or sponge works well for this.
- Allow the floor to air dry completely before walking on it or replacing any area rugs.



















Maintaining Your Ceramic Tile Floor
Regular cleaning and maintenance are key to keeping your ceramic tile floor looking its best. Here are some tips:
- Sweep or vacuum your floor regularly to remove dirt and debris.
- Mop your floor weekly with your homemade cleaner to prevent dirt buildup.
- Avoid using abrasive tools or harsh chemicals, which can damage the tile's finish.
- Address spills promptly to prevent staining.
